corticosterone

 

Definitions from WordNet

Noun corticosterone has 1 sense
  1. corticosterone - secreted by the adrenal cortex; involved in regulating water and electrolyte balance in the body
    --1 is a kind of
    glucocorticoid

Definitions from the Web

Corticosterone


Definition:

Corticosterone is a glucocorticoid hormone produced in the adrenal cortex, which plays a crucial role in regulating metabolism, immune response, and stress levels in the body.

Sample Sentences:

  1. High levels of corticosterone can lead to muscle wasting and weakened immune function.
  2. The corticosterone levels in the patient indicated a possible adrenal gland dysfunction.
  3. Scientists have observed that corticosterone influences the formation of new memories.
